remote dba support
    HomeOracle InternalsWhat Is Oracle Asm And How Does It Work?

    What Is Oracle Asm And How Does It Work?

    Oracle Automatic Storage Management (ASM) is integral to Oracle Database software. It is a volume-management and file-management system designed to manage data, Oracle database, and control files. ASM provides:

    • Automatic load balancing across multiple disks.
    • Improved performance and scalability.
    • Simplified storage management for large databases.

    This article will provide an overview of Oracle ASM and its workings.

    - Advertisement -

    Oracle Automatic Storage Management (ASM) has become increasingly popular in recent years due to its ability to simplify the management of large databases that often require scaling as their size increases. ASM allows for the dynamic allocation of disk space and automated rebalancing of disk volumes across multiple disks and servers. Additionally, ASM provides greater flexibility in data storage and retrieval by allowing users to customize the layout of their database files according to their needs.

    Oracle ASM offers many advantages over traditional storage systems, such as improved performance, scalability, availability, and cost savings on storage hardware purchases. Oracle ASM helps organizations improve efficiency while reducing costs associated with manual storage management processes by providing a simple yet powerful tool for managing data storage needs. In this article, we will explore Oracle ASM and how it works to help readers better understand its capabilities and potential benefits for their organization.

    What Is Oracle Asm?

    Oracle Automatic Storage Management (ASM) is software for managing disk storage in an Oracle Database. Oracle ASM provides the ability to manage disk-based storage with the same ease and reliability as memory-based storage, thus eliminating the need for manual maintenance and configuration of disk-related activities. Like an experienced navigator, it offers a smooth ride through the turbulent waters of data management.

    The building blocks of Oracle ASM are filesystems and disks, which provide the basis for organizing and storing data. Using these components, Oracle ASM can create disk groups consisting of multiple disks or files that can be used to store files, such as tablespaces, indexes, and other objects related to the database. It also allows multiple databases to share resources on different devices while maintaining configurations.

    - Advertisement -

    Oracle ASM is designed to reduce complexity and improve performance by providing a dynamic resource allocation system that automatically adjusts available resources based on usage patterns. This optimization capability helps ensure that each database instance has access to the optimal amount of resources at any given time, allowing for efficient disk space utilization while maximizing throughput. In addition, its self-monitoring mechanism ensures free disks are identified and available when needed.

    Advantages Of Oracle Asm:

    Oracle Automatic Storage Management (ASM) has become an increasingly popular storage solution for organizations and has been seen to improve system performance by up to 20%1. It is a software-only solution that helps simplify the management of Oracle database files, reducing the administrative overhead associated with managing them. This article will discuss the advantages of using Oracle ASM.

    Oracle ASM provides many benefits for IT teams dealing with complex storage requirements. The most notable advantage is that it simplifies managing database files, allowing users to quickly locate and access files as needed. Additionally, Oracle ASM offers improved scalability and flexibility when configuring disk storage. For instance, users can easily add or remove disk groups without reconfiguring existing structures. Furthermore, it also supports a wide range of features such as mirroring, striping, and dynamic reallocation of resources which can be used to increase system performance and availability.

    Oracle ASM also enables organizations to reduce their overall cost for storage solutions since all required components are provided in one package. Furthermore, it provides detailed monitoring so that administrators can identify any problems related to storage usage before they become critical issues. Finally, its intuitive graphical interface makes it easier for users needing more extensive technical knowledge to manage their database files effectively and efficiently.

    By utilizing Oracle ASM’s various features, organizations can significantly improve their storage infrastructure while lowering costs at the same time. All these benefits make Oracle ASM an attractive option for those looking for a reliable and practical storage solution that is both easy to use and economical in terms of cost savings over traditional methods.

    How Does Oracle Asm Work?

    Oracle ASM is like an orchestra conductor, unifying different components to create a harmonious result. It is a volume manager and a file system for Oracle Database files that uses disk groups as logical storage units. It works by providing a layer between the physical disks and the database files, making it easy to manage them.

    When Oracle ASM is used, it takes care of the layout of the data across multiple disks and manages the available space on each disk. It helps to ensure that read and write operations are optimized. In addition, Oracle ASM provides features such as automatic data rebalancing when new disks are added to existing disk groups and mirroring data across multiple disks for redundancy.

    The primary benefit of using Oracle ASM is its simplicity. This system allows administrators to easily manage Oracle Database files without having an extensive understanding of storage architectures or manually configuring storage devices such as RAID arrays. The ability to dynamically add new disks into existing disk groups allows for more effortless scalability. Overall, Oracle ASM provides an efficient way of storing and managing Oracle Database files with minimal administrator effort.

    Oracle Asm Architecture Overview:

    An Oracle Automatic Storage Management (ASM) system is a software-based feature of the Oracle Database that simplifies the storage, management, and retrieval of database files. Leveraging the power of virtualization, it provides an abstract layer between physical storage resources and logical databases. This system allows database administrators to easily manage file transfer operations and create and remove database files without manual intervention. Astonishingly, ASM also offers high availability through its automated failover capabilities.

    Oracle ASM architecture consists of three components – the ASM instance, disks, and disk groups. The ASM instance is the core component that manages all database-related operations like file mapping and permissions. This component intermediates between the database server and physical disks or disk groups. It also keeps track of available storage capacity for each disk group so that new files can be added or removed accordingly. Disks store data, while disk groups are collections of disks managed together by the ASM instance.

    Oracle ASM further helps improve performance by automatically distributing data across multiple disks inside a disk group to optimize I/O access patterns while ensuring data integrity through redundancy options such as mirroring or RAID-like striping techniques. In addition to this, it also enables administrators to perform routine maintenance activities like adding or removing disks from a disk group without taking down the entire system. Furthermore, its sophisticated failover mechanisms provide efficient recovery from hardware faults in case of a failure scenario without any manual intervention required from administrators – truly empowering users with a sense of control over their systems.

    Oracle Asm Components:

    Oracle Automatic Storage Manager (ASM) is a revolutionary storage management system changing how we think about data storage. It is a unique and powerful tool that provides unparalleled control over the physical files that make up our databases. ASM provides a framework of components that can be used to easily manage, secure, and protect large amounts of data.

    At the heart of Oracle ASM are its components: Disk Groups, Disks, and Files. Disk Groups are collections of disks that hold the actual data files. The disks within the group are divided into one or more sub-groups called Failure Groups. Each Failure Group contains at least two disks to maximize redundancy in case of disk failure or other errors. Files are then stored on these disks, with each file containing multiple extents spread across multiple disks to improve read/write performance.

    The modular design of Oracle ASM allows it to be easily configured and modified to suit individual needs. The user has total control over which disks are assigned to which groups, how many extents each file will have, and where each extent should be placed for optimal performance. This flexibility makes Oracle ASM an ideal choice for businesses looking for maximum control over their data storage solutions.

    Disk Groups In Oracle Asm:

    Undoubtedly, Oracle Automatic Storage Management (ASM) is one of the most popular storage technologies today, but many people need help understanding its inner workings. Specifically, disk groups are a critical component of ASM, yet they are often overlooked. To better understand how ASM functions, it is crucial to understand disk groups and their purpose.

    Disk groups in Oracle ASM are logical containers for storing files and objects. Essentially, they provide a way for the system to identify disks that belong to the same group and can be used together. This allows for improved performance and scalability of the system as more disks can be added to the group when needed. Additionally, disk groups provide redundancy by mirroring data across multiple disks within the group. That ensures that if one disk fails, the data will still be accessible from another in the same group.

    To access data stored in ASM, administrators must first create a disk group in which they define specific parameters such as the number of disks allowed per group, the size of each disk, and the type of replication used for redundancy. Once this is done, all files and objects stored on any given disk in the group can be accessed quickly and efficiently as they are identified by their location within the group’s configuration hierarchy.

    Understanding what disk groups are and how they work within Oracle ASM makes it easier to understand why this storage technology has become so popular over the years – it allows for efficient storage management with scalability, redundancy, and quick access times for stored data. As such, utilizing disk groups within Oracle ASM gives administrators greater control over their storage environment while ensuring reliable performance over time.

    Oracle Asm Storage Configuration:

    It is understandable to be sceptical of Oracle ASM as a storage configuration option due to the complexity of this type of system. However, Oracle ASM can provide an effective data storage method with careful setup and management. This article will explain the key features of Oracle ASM and discuss how it works.

    Oracle Automatic Storage Management (ASM) is a feature that simplifies the storage management process. It provides a platform-independent layer between physical disk drives and their applications. It consists of disk groups, which are collections of physical disks combined into one large logical volume. Each disk group contains one or more disks, each divided into one or more allocation units (AU). The AU’s are then divided into extents that Oracle Database uses for storing data or other files.

    Oracle ASM also includes an automatic balancing feature that allows it to redistribute data across all available disks to improve performance and increase availability. The system also has other features, such as mirroring and striping, which further help to maximize performance and minimize downtime in case of hardware failure. Additionally, the system can be configured to automatically detect when a disk fails and take action accordingly, ensuring that no data is lost due to hardware issues.

    Overall, Oracle ASM provides an efficient solution for managing storage across multiple servers while providing maximum flexibility and reliability regarding performance, availability, and security. With its automated balancing feature and other features such as mirroring and striping, Oracle ASM effectively manages large amounts of data without compromising performance or reliability.

    Oracle Asm File Management:

    Oracle ASM, the storage configuration solution of many enterprises, has earned a reputation as an efficient, reliable way to manage file systems. But many must realize that Oracle ASM is also a powerful file management tool. From disk groups to file permissions, Oracle ASM provides a comprehensive suite of features to help administrators maintain total control over their data storage environment.

    The first step in setting up and managing an Oracle ASM file system is to create disk groups and assign them to specific files. This process requires careful consideration, as it helps determine which files are available and where they can be stored on the system. Once the disk groups have been created and assigned, administrators can assign access rights and privileges to users and applications needing access. It allows admins to control who can view or modify each file.

    Finally, Oracle ASM makes monitoring file usage and performance easy across all connected devices. Through its built-in analytics capabilities, admins can keep tabs on how often individual files are accessed or modified, allowing them to adjust settings accordingly. That ensures that resources are being used in the most efficient manner possible without sacrificing security or reliability. In short, Oracle ASM provides administrators with ultimate control over their data storage environment – empowering them with the tools they need to deliver secure, reliable data solutions for their organizations.

    Oracle Asm Rebalancing:

    Oracle ASM Rebalancing is an essential process for maintaining and optimizing Oracle systems. It is a powerful tool that can ensure peak performance from an Oracle system’s hardware and software components. As such, it is one of the most important aspects of Oracle administration.

    The rebalancing process works by redistributing the data stored in an Oracle system across multiple disks. It helps to achieve even levels of performance across all disks, ensuring that every disk is adequately utilized. The rebalancing algorithm optimizes disk storage space to fully utilize all available capacity.

    Furthermore, when combined with automatic storage management (ASM), Oracle ASM Rebalancing provides additional features such as real-time monitoring and alerting, allowing administrators to respond quickly to environmental issues or changes. With these capabilities, Oracle ASM Rebalancing gives administrators complete control over their infrastructure to maintain peak performance and reliability.

    Oracle Asm Data Protection:

    Oracle Automatic Storage Management (ASM) is a software layer that provides data protection and storage management for Oracle databases. It is an enterprise-level solution that uses intelligent algorithms to provide redundancy, scalability, and database performance. ASM uses disk groups to manage the physical disks associated with a database. ASM distributes data on the disks within each disk group to balance performance and distribute accesses across the disks.

    The primary purpose of Oracle ASM is to protect against disk failures by providing redundancy through mirroring and striping of the data. In addition, ASM also provides dynamic rebalancing capabilities, which allow it to adjust the placement of data on different disks based on usage patterns or system changes. That ensures optimal performance and load balancing across all the disks in a given disk group, making it easier for administrators to manage their system’s resources.

    Oracle ASM is an essential tool for database administrators who must ensure their systems are secure and reliable. By leveraging advanced technologies such as mirroring, striping, and rebalancing, Oracle ASM can provide administrators with peace of mind knowing their databases are safe from unexpected outages or disruptions due to storage-related issues. Additionally, with its ability to dynamically adjust its data placement strategy, Oracle ASM makes it easier for administrators to maintain optimal system performance while minimizing downtime caused by storage-related issues.

    Oracle Asm Dynamic Volume Extension:

    Proper protection of data is an essential part of any modern business. Oracle Automatic Storage Management (Oracle ASM) Dynamic Volume Extension (DVE) offers a secure and reliable way to extend the capacity of a storage volume efficiently and cost-effectively. This article examines how Oracle ASM DVE works and its advantages for businesses.

    Flawless functioning is fundamental for businesses when extending their storage capacity. Oracle ASM DVE allows users to extend their storage volumes without disrupting their existing operations. It does this by automatically resizing the underlying file system, eliminating manual intervention and thus reducing operational costs. It also allows users to transparently increase their storage space without changing the database or applications that rely on the comprehensive volume.

    Finally, Oracle ASM DVE is an ideal solution for companies to securely and efficiently extend their storage capacity. It offers a secure platform with automated processes that reduce administrative overhead while increasing reliability and scalability. Furthermore, its ease of use makes it an excellent choice for businesses of all sizes who want to increase their storage capacity without disruption or additional costs.

    Oracle Asm Usage Considerations:

    Oracle Automatic Storage Management (ASM) is a feature of the Oracle database providing an alternative to traditional file systems for storage. It provides a unified view of the database’s storage and simplifies management tasks by eliminating the need to manually create and manage individual files. ASM also offers improved performance and scalability compared to traditional file systems.

    When using Oracle ASM, several considerations must be taken into account. For example, it should not be used with multi-node databases or databases running on shared storage devices such as Fibre Channel or iSCSI. Additionally, when deploying in a clustered environment, it is essential to ensure that each node has access to the same underlying storage devices to maintain high availability and data integrity.

    Finally, Oracle ASM requires additional license fees due to its advanced features and capabilities. As such, it is crucial to consider this when weighing up whether or not it is an appropriate solution for your particular needs. If you decide that Oracle ASM suits your requirements, proper planning and configuration will be necessary to ensure your system operates effectively and efficiently.

    Troubleshooting Oracle Asm:

    Oracle Automatic Storage Management (Oracle ASM) has become increasingly popular as an easy-to-use storage solution for Oracle databases. According to a survey of Oracle users conducted in 2019, 92% of respondents reported using Oracle ASM on their systems. It shows that most organizations have adopted the technology, but it also indicates that troubleshooting issues with Oracle ASM can be complex and time-consuming.

    The primary challenge of troubleshooting Oracle ASM is that the underlying cause of problems may take time to be apparent. Often, an issue’s root lies deep within the system configuration or user settings. To properly diagnose these kinds of problems, it is essential to understand how Oracle ASM works and what components interact with each other to keep a database running smoothly.

    The best way to approach troubleshooting Oracle ASM is to identify potential sources of errors and then systematically eliminate them one by one until the root cause has been discovered. It is essential to approach this process in an organized fashion, as it can quickly become overwhelming if done haphazardly. Additionally, having access to expert knowledge or experienced personnel can help speed up the troubleshooting process by providing valuable insights into potential areas where errors may exist. Administrators can ensure that their systems remain stable and reliable by taking these steps.

    Comparing Oracle Asm To Other Storage Options:

    Storage solutions are critical for managing data and keeping it safe from harm. Oracle Automatic Storage Management (ASM) is an option many organizations use to ensure their data is secure. This article will compare Oracle ASM to other storage options and discuss the benefits and drawbacks of each.

    Oracle ASM is a file-based storage management system that provides automated data protection, redundancy, and scalability. It also allows the quickly creating of new databases with minimal setup time. Oracle ASM reduces complexity by eliminating the need for manual configuration of multiple disks or files systems while making it easier to manage large amounts of data. Additionally, Oracle ASM offers advanced features such as a redundant array of independent disks (RAID), snapshot copies, and encryption capabilities.

    Other storage solutions may offer similar features but need more automation and flexibility found in Oracle ASM. For example, traditional disk mirroring requires manual configuration and can be challenging to maintain when dealing with large volumes of data. Additionally, RAID-level configurations are complex and require more setup time than Oracle ASM’s automation capabilities allow disk IO distribution. Furthermore, these other storage options may need to be more reliable in providing redundancy or protecting against data loss due to power outages or other disruptions.

    In comparison, Oracle ASM provides an efficient solution for managing large volumes of data while maintaining redundancy and ease of use. Its automated processes make it ideal for organizations needing quick data access without sacrificing reliability or security. The range of features offered with Oracle ASM also makes it a powerful choice when managing complex storage needs.

    Summary Of Oracle Asm Benefits:

    Oracle ASM is an application that allows storage systems to be managed efficiently and securely. It has been gaining popularity as a storage option due to its many inherent benefits. This article will explore the advantages of using Oracle ASM, concisely summarizing the key benefits.

    Oracle ASM offers superior application performance compared to traditional storage solutions. It is due to its ability to automatically allocate disk space and distribute files among multiple disks, reducing contention and improving system throughput. Furthermore, Oracle ASM provides high availability by automatically mirroring data across multiple disks, ensuring that valuable data remains intact even if one disk fails.

    Finally, Oracle ASM ensures security and reliability by encrypting data stored on disks and maintaining checksums for each file stored on the system. That helps prevent malicious access or accidental damage to critical business data stored on the system. In addition, it also has advanced features such as dynamic rebalancing, which redistributes data across disks when needed, and optimized reads which reduce input/output operations per second (IOPS).

    Oracle ASM, therefore, provides organizations with an effective solution for managing storage systems securely and reliably while maximizing performance. With its superior performance, high availability, encryption capabilities, dynamic rebalancing, and optimized reads, Oracle ASM is quickly becoming one of the most popular storage solutions.


    Oracle ASM is a powerful and efficient storage solution for the Oracle Database. It offers numerous advantages, including improved database performance, simplified storage management, and enhanced data protection. The Oracle ASM architecture is designed to provide flexibility and scalability for database administrators, allowing them to easily manage their storage resources. Furthermore, Oracle ASM provides many usage considerations that can help users optimize their storage resources.

    For those seeking an efficient and reliable solution for managing their Oracle databases, Oracle ASM is an excellent choice. It offers advanced features such as automated data balancing and load balancing, allowing users to quickly troubleshoot any potential issues with its built-in diagnostics tools. Moreover, compared to other storage options available today, Oracle ASM stands out due to its robust feature set and reliable performance.

    In conclusion, Oracle ASM is a top-notch storage solution that offers numerous benefits over other alternatives. With its scalability, reliability, and advanced features, such as automated data balancing and load balancing, it’s no wonder many organizations are turning to this powerful solution to manage their databases. If you’re interested in maximizing your database performance while simplifying your storage management tasks simultaneously, consider seriously harnessing the power of Oracle ASM!

    When you want to make a strong Oracle DBA career then you should be aware of database services and other database technology. Without having knowledge of Oracle internals, Oracle performance tuning, and skill of Oracle database troubleshooting you can’t be an Oracle DBA expert.

    This expert DBA Team club blog always provides you latest technology news and database news to keep yourself up to date. You should need to be aware of Cloud database technology like DBaaS. These all Oracle DBA tips are available in a single unique resource at our orageek. Meanwhile, we are also providing some sql tutorials for Oracle DBA. This is the part of Dbametrix Group and you would enjoy more advanced topics from our partner resource.

    - Advertisement -
    - Advertisment -
    remote dba services

    Most Popular